Output 8ee60fc8e68cc0f6ef93cc6036626194c2188dbd0440d00e346e31f175c62412:0

value
38816763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d78e015ed41f183a3fa14b548a93b8b03c7408e OP_EQUAL
address
MC3bSdNyoCKxmXqQYhmf6yhtmUQQQVVABW
transaction
8ee60fc8e68cc0f6ef93cc6036626194c2188dbd0440d00e346e31f175c62412
spent
true